Types of orders in trading play a vital role in managing trades and achieving investment goals. The basic types of orders include: market order, which executes immediately at the best available price; and limit order, which sets a specific price for buying or selling, allowing the trader to control the price. There are also stop-loss orders, which help to minimize losses by automatically selling at a specified price. In addition, there are stop-limit orders, which combine the features of limit and stop orders. Understanding these types helps traders make strategic decisions and maximize their benefits from market movements.
The comparison between centralized exchanges (CEX) and decentralized exchanges (DEX) relates to how cryptocurrencies are traded. Centralized exchanges like Binance provide high liquidity and a smooth user experience, as the assets are managed by the exchange itself. This offers additional security but requires trust in the exchange. On the other hand, decentralized exchanges allow users to trade directly with each other without an intermediary, enhancing privacy and personal control over assets. However, DEX may face challenges in liquidity and execution speed. The choice between CEX and DEX depends on user preferences regarding security, privacy, and convenience.

The cryptocurrency project World Liberty Financial, backed by former U.S. President Donald Trump, has announced plans to launch a new stablecoin called USD1, which will be redeemable for U.S. dollars. The currency will be backed by short-term Treasury bonds and dollar deposits, with BitGo serving as the custodian. It will be minted on the Ethereum and Binance Smart Chain blockchains, and the launch is scheduled for today, with just one hour remaining until the USD1 coin is launched.
The Trump-backed administration aims to promote the use of stablecoins, which are digital tokens designed to maintain a stable value through traditional assets. The USD1 project aims to provide a reliable stablecoin for institutional investors to facilitate cross-border transactions.
While stablecoins enjoy strong support from Washington, they face criticism for their use by criminals in moving money across borders. There are also concerns about their potential negative impact on the financial system during times of crisis.
World Liberty Financial was established last September as a decentralized finance project, aiming to provide financial services without intermediaries USD1
